Transaction 31a77364b0b69b34a9249112377b49e7ce42fb87237fc2f68ac5af96cdf35623
1 Input
1 Output
-
31a77364b0b69b34a9249112377b49e7ce42fb87237fc2f68ac5af96cdf35623:0
- value
- 902460
- script pubkey
- OP_0 OP_PUSHBYTES_20 75fa712595333b01dc99e54fcd7bd7213ca04cce
- address
- bc1qwha8zfv4xvasrhyeu48u677hyy72qnxwhkhtps